The SmartCara PCS750 is a fully enclosed kitchen composting system designed for automated processing of food scraps. It uses heat, airflow, and mechanical agitation to reduce organic waste volume while controlling odor. This guide explains how to install, adjust, maintain, and optimize the SmartCara PCS750 for consistent performance in a home kitchen environment. All instructions apply only to the SmartCara PCS750 model.
Product Overview and System Components
The SmartCara PCS750 consists of a sealed processing chamber, a removable compost bucket, a carbon-based odor filtration system, an internal mixing blade, and a digital control interface. These components work together to dry, aerate, and partially decompose food waste. Because the system relies on internal airflow and heat, correct setup is essential for safe and efficient operation.

Initial Setup and Installation
Place the SmartCara PCS750 on a stable, level surface near a power outlet. Adequate clearance on all sides ensures proper airflow and heat dissipation. Before powering the unit, remove the compost bucket and confirm that the internal mixing blade rotates freely. Insert the bucket fully until it locks into position. Proper alignment prevents vibration and motor strain during operation.
Once positioned, connect the unit to power. The control panel will illuminate, indicating standby mode. At this stage, the system is ready for configuration. Because the SmartCara PCS750 is pre-calibrated at the factory, no software adjustments are required during first-time setup.
Operational Adjustment and Daily Use
The SmartCara PCS750 operates on automated processing cycles. Food scraps should be added gradually rather than in large batches. This approach improves drying efficiency and reduces mechanical resistance on the mixing blade. Moist food waste such as vegetable peels benefits from light pre-draining before insertion.
After adding waste, close the lid firmly to maintain the sealed environment. The system begins processing automatically based on internal sensors. During operation, airflow passes through the carbon filter to neutralize odors. As a result, the unit remains suitable for countertop or under-counter placement.
Routine Maintenance Procedures
Regular maintenance ensures long-term reliability. The compost bucket should be emptied once it reaches the manufacturer’s recommended fill level. Emptying earlier improves airflow and reduces internal humidity. After removal, wipe the bucket interior with a dry cloth. Avoid water exposure inside the main unit housing.
The carbon filter requires periodic replacement to maintain odor control. Reduced airflow or lingering smells indicate filter saturation. Replacing the filter restores normal ventilation efficiency. Additionally, inspect the mixing blade monthly to ensure no hardened residue restricts movement.
Troubleshooting Common Setup Issues
If the unit fails to start, confirm that the compost bucket is fully seated. The SmartCara PCS750 includes a safety interlock that prevents operation when the bucket is misaligned. In cases of excessive noise, uneven placement is the most common cause. Re-leveling the unit typically resolves vibration.
Odor issues during early use often result from overloading or excess moisture. Reducing input volume and allowing a full processing cycle usually corrects the problem. If the control panel displays an error, power cycling the unit resets most sensor-related interruptions.
Customization and Performance Optimization
Performance improves when waste composition remains balanced. Mixing drier food scraps with wetter materials supports efficient dehydration. Although the SmartCara PCS750 automates aeration, avoiding large bones or fibrous materials reduces mechanical stress.
Space efficiency can be improved by integrating the unit into a dedicated waste management area. Consistent placement prevents accidental movement that could affect airflow alignment. For odor control optimization, replacing filters slightly ahead of schedule is effective in warm or humid kitchens.
Compatibility With Related Composting Accessories
The SmartCara PCS750 is compatible with compostable liner bags designed for high-temperature environments. Bags must be certified for heat resistance to prevent melting. Standard countertop caddies can be used for temporary collection before transferring scraps to the unit.
Aeration accessories are not required due to the internal mixing mechanism. However, approved carbon filter replacements are essential for maintaining airflow balance. Using non-approved filters may restrict ventilation and reduce system efficiency.
Comparison With Similar Kitchen Composting Systems
Compared to passive countertop bins, the SmartCara PCS750 offers automated processing and active odor control. Unlike manual compost caddies, it reduces waste volume and moisture without user intervention. When compared with smaller electric composters, the PCS750 provides a larger processing capacity and a more robust filtration system.
However, the SmartCara PCS750 requires consistent power and scheduled maintenance. Users prioritizing automation and reduced handling benefit most from this design. Those seeking a non-electric solution may prefer simpler bins, though with reduced performance.
